The Third International Ratings Forum was held

UZBEKISTAN, May 6 – The May 7, the Third International Ratings Forum took place in Tashkent.
This forum was mainly focused on the impact of economic reforms in Uzbekistan on the country’s position in global international rankings. The Forum started with the Opening Ceremony then continued with sessions related to environmental issues, prospects for the development of the digital economy, social awareness, economic challenges in the reform agenda and the rule of law and the fight against corruption. The listed sessions were held by expert economists as well as civil servants, where they highlighted government efforts in each mentioned sector, talked about the challenges they face and suggested possible solutions. Moreover, during the Q&A sessions, the speakers were asked different questions by the audience, which were followed by detailed answers from them.

Next “Economic challenges in the reform program” Session participants agreed that Uzbekistan should continue to create a better investment and business climate, efficient market mechanisms. So far, remarkable progress in economic reforms can be observed. To name but a few, the liberalization of the foreign exchange market, the issuance of the first Eurobonds, the privatization of state assets, the elimination of a number of administrative obstacles, the reform tax, the reduction of a number of administrative costs linked to business.
